The Queen's Head and Artichoke is a delightful pub nestled away on the corner of Longford and Albany streets. The pub looks like a late Victorian pub, it offers a tapas menu, enticing for a longer visit. Dog friendly and a very happy go lucky atmosphere. The service is excellent and the beer is great too. Indeed, a fine offering of keg beers along with a couple of cask ales. A fine place indeed.

The Queens Head & Artichoke is located at the end of a Victorian terrace near the south east corner of Regents Park. The nearest Tube is Great Portland Street which is a few minutes walk away. . When Regent's Park was created, several Inns were demolished including the Queens Head. It re-located to this spot in 1811 and the name was extended to the Queen's Head & Artichoke by 1825. The pub was re-built in its present form in 1900. . The decor here is full of old world charm with some stunning features, most notably the beautiful servery. The walls are clad in Georgian panelling and there is a striking fireplace with yellow glazed tiles. There is plenty of seating which is great but disappointingly it is not in keeping with the rest of the boozer. Another impressive feature is the tall rolled glass windows which bathe the pub with light. .
